程骏,中科院博士生导师,慈溪医工所“团队人才”研究员,2016年入选浙江省人才计划,宁波市3315团队核心成员。 2008年获得新加坡南洋理工大学博士学位,后加入松下新加坡实验室。2009年加入新加坡科研局,先后担任研究员,资深研究员,科学家,资深科学家。2017年全职加入慈溪医工所。担任医疗影像顶级期刊IEEE Transactions on Medical Imaging (中科院一区)副主编,MICCAI的领域主席, 眼科专项会议OMIA编委。
主要研究方向包括人工智能、机器视觉、模式识别、虚拟现实与增强现实、图像处理等。在智能医疗影像处理领域尤其是眼科影像处理领域作出大量工作,在TMI,TIP, TBME, MICCAI, CVPR等知名国际期刊和国际会议上发表SCI/EI论文100余篇, 其中顶级/权威期刊和顶级会议文章20余篇。

Jun Cheng received the B. E. degree in electronic engineering and information science from the University of Science and Technology of China, and the Ph. D. degree in electrical and electronic engineering from Nanyang Technological University, Singapore. In 2009, he joined the Institute for Infocomm Research, Agency of Science, Technology and Research (A*STAR), Singapore. Earlier, he worked for more than two years with Panasonic Singapore Laboratories.
He is now a professor in Cixi Institute of Biomedical Engineering, Chinese Academy of Sciences, China. He was a senior scientist and the research lead in the Intelligent Medical Imaging (iMED) department in the Institute for Infocomm Research, leading the research of medical image processing & understanding. He has developed many algorithms for automated ocular disease detection including glaucoma, age-related macular degeneration, pathological myopia. He has received the IES Prestigious Engineering Achievement Award 2013. His research interests include computer vision, image processing, medical imaging and machine learning. Previously, he worked on automatic glaucoma screening in AGLAIA project and his technology for glaucoma screening has been licensed. He is currently the PI of the Automatic Cardiac optical coherence Tomograph Image Analysis for coronary artery disease risk assessment (ACTIA) project. He has authored/co-authored many publications at prestigious journals/conferences, such as TMI, TIP, TBME, IOVS, JAMIA, MICCAI, CVPR and invented more than 10 patents. He serves as reviewers for many journal and conferences. He is currently associate editor for TMI.
